Move over Oprah, here are Jason Starr’s summer reading picks for Summer, 2008. These novels are guaranteed to entertain you, thrill you, and scare the hell out of you while you’re lying on the beach this summer.
ONCE WERE COPS by Ken Bruen
This novel won’t be out till the fall, but I read an advance copy and this will undoubtedly be Bruen’s big breakout thriller. An Irish cop joins the NYPD in an exchange program and hell ensues. If you love Bruen’s Jack Taylor and Brant series (and, well, the books he co-writes with me–BUST, SLIDE, and the forthcoming THE MAX), you’ll love ONCE WERE COPS. This is the perfect novel to attract new readers to Bruen’s work.
REVENGE TANGO by Jerry A. Rodriguez
Rodriguez’s first novel, THE DEVIL’S MAMBO, got a lot of acclaim last year, and his follow up REVENGE TANGO is even better. Ex-cop and Lotto winner Nicholas Esperanza returns to settle a score with a brutal femme fatale. Spot-on depictions of life in el barrio of Manhattan.
SIX SICK HIPSTERS by Rayo Casablanca
This is the novel the hipster generation has been wating for. Casablanca has a great ear for dialogue and capturing the lifestyle of twenty-somethings in New York City.
BONEYARD by Michelle Gagnon
This is Gagnon’s second novel featuring FBI investigator Kelly Jones, after last year’s superb THE TUNNELS. BONEYARD is set in the Berkshires where Jones is on the trail of a team of serial killers committing grisly murders. Jones is a wonderful protagonist and you won’t be able to put this book down during the last hundred pages. Fans of Jeffery Deaver, Thomas Harris and John Sandford will love BONEYARD.
CRIMINAL by Ed Brubaker
The latest installment of Brubaker’s Eisner-winning graphic novel series is now in stores. I loved Lawless and Coward and these are must reads for all crime/noir fans.
HEARTLESS by Alison Gaylin
The new thriller by the author Harlan Coben calls his “new must read.” A soap opera writer goes off with her boyfriend to San Esteben, Mexico and, well, some very strange things happern. Edgar nominee Gaylin (TRASHED, YOU KILL ME) delivers another great page turner.
